Be Bad Radio Launches June 12

MORGANTOWN, W.V. Be Bad Entertainment presents its newest production on its radio station Be Bad Radio.

Be Bad Entertainment launches Be Bad Radio Wednesday June 12 at 10 p.m. EST.

The show, “Being Bad with ES,” features hostess Empress Sunshine aka ES and her co-hostess Chloe Bureal aka Chloe B.

“Being Bad with ES” plans to bring entertainment with education about all things adult and the myths and truths of the fetish world.

“It is adult talk radio so ES plans to make sure the listeners can get in on the discussion as well,” said Shenaee Masters, CEO of Be Bad Entertainment and Be Bad Radio.

The company said ES takes listeners on an unfiltered verbal ride through the adult world discussing it all from society’s sex norm to the kinkiest of fetishes and sex acts.

The show plans to open minds and educate people.

Different show questions entitled “ES Wants to Know?” will be posted on the website, blog, and twitter, prior to the show.

The audience listens on the Be Bad Radio Station on BlogTalkRadio or their phones by calling in on (646) 564-9973.
